Transaction 2740316f20942dee551a928c51eb0f4a858336217eb531ae30612af79807f0bf

1 Input
2 Outputs
  • 2740316f20942dee551a928c51eb0f4a858336217eb531ae30612af79807f0bf:0
  • value  34675444
    address  1PSKhPAonJRU4oTer3NbeH2AoN3WEfBdE9
  • 2740316f20942dee551a928c51eb0f4a858336217eb531ae30612af79807f0bf:1
  • value  6164387
    address  1Hq6odBaRu75pLQDWoR6ySgRCgPxarqqH3